MATLAB for Neuroscientists serves as the only complete study manual and teaching resource for MATLAB, the globally accepted standard for scientific computing, in the neurosciences and psychology. This unique introduction can be used to learn the entire empirical and experimental process (including stimulus generation, experimental control, data collection, data analysis, modeling, and more), and the 2nd Edition continues to ensure that many computational problems can be addressed in a single programming environment.§This updated edition features additional material on the creation of visual stimuli, advanced psychophysics, analysis of LFP data, choice probabilities, synchrony, and advanced spectral analysis. Users at a variety of levels-advanced undergraduates, beginning graduate students, and researchers looking to modernize their skills-will learn to design and implement their own analytical tools. This book will aid researchers and students in achieving the fluency required to meet the computational needs of neuroscience practitioners.§Completely revised and expanded second edition keeps up with developments within neuroscience as well as MATLAB §All computational approaches explained by using genuine experimental data, providing the unique look and feel of real empirical data §The first comprehensive textbook on MATLAB with a focus on its applications in neuroscience and psychology §Careful didactic approach focused on problem solving §Authors are award-winning educators with strong teaching experience §Companion website with image bank, executable code, examples, and solutions available
